Influenced by the Fine Arts

Lara has painted ever since she had the motor skills to. She was inspired by her father, Jeff Renaud. She often watched as he created his masterpieces of color in the garage and knew from a young age that making art would also be her passion. Lara studied at at Pratt MWP, NY, where she learned Classic painting and color theory from painters Christopher Cirilo and Gregg Lawler. She studied drawing and life drawing under Steve Arnison and Eulia Neal at Pratt MWP, NY, and Ardis DeFreece at the Pacific Northwest School of the Arts, OR. The skills she developed under these masters, in addition to her studies of the Impressionists, Cubists, and French Canadian landscape artists, influenced her style and creativity in the digital arts.
